Sperm meets egg plan (SMEP) suggests EOD from CD8 til positive OPK, then the next 3 days, day's rest, then one more day. But EOD from the beginning of your fertile period until you're certain OV has been and gone should do.

DTD prior to OV is preferable, so sperm is waiting for eggy!! :-)
